How to Use Grocery Discount Codes Effectively

1. Check Codes Before Shopping

Before checking out, always verify that the promo code is:

  • Current and not expired

  • Applicable to your items

  • Finalized discount (no surprises at checkout)

2. Stack Codes with Loyalty Programs

Many stores allow you to use grocery discount codes with loyalty rewards, store points, or digital coupons, leading to deeper savings.

3. Use Grocery Apps

Most supermarkets have mobile apps that refresh weekly coupons and codes. These often include:

  • App‑exclusive discount codes

  • Personalized offers based on purchase history

  • Digital clip‑to‑card savings

4. Combine with Cashback

Activate cashback portals like Rakuten before you shop (in‑store or online) so you earn a percentage back in addition to your promo code savings.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Even with weekly updated codes, shoppers often make avoidable errors:

❌ Using expired or unverified codes
❌ Not checking the code restrictions (minimum spend, category limits)
❌ Ignoring store loyalty and digital coupons
❌ Forgetting to stack cashback offers

Avoiding these pitfalls ensures every grocery shop gives you the maximum value.
